What are the 2 particles that make up the nucleus of an atom?

Protons and neutrons compose the nucleus of an atom. Most of the mass of an atom exists in the nucleus. Other smaller sub atomic particles such as quarks exist, but are usually not addressed until advanced physics or chemistry classes.
